Quinno _ left this review about White Lion

Two room locals redoubt via an entry porch. The right hand side is labelled ‘snug’ but there is nothing snug about it, just a stripped-back public bar with the Rugby Union World Cup on the tellybox plus a dart board. The left side is plusher and had a dozen punters in, though a pure sausage fest bar the teenage barmaid who was on the end of some good-natured ribbing from said Richmonds. The salmon, vomit and anaemic pea colour scheme is atrocious but there was a bit of atmosphere at least. A single cask of Butcombe Original which was in decent nick (NBSS 3). A fair local. 5.5

Blackthorn _ left this review about The White Lion

A traditional old pub in a residential part of Nailsea, it’s very much a local’s pub and is unlikely to have changed much in decades consequently feeling somewhat dated rather than having any “olde worlde” charm. It consists of a couple of bars along with a beer garden at the rear.

The larger bar was to the left and a smaller snug to the right, although we did not investigate this. The central bar counter serves both bars. Decor wise it follows the traditional and unimaginative old pub ambience with red patterned carpet on the floor, red velour on the seats, red curtains at the windows, and so on. The paintwork is a mixture of deep salmon and cream and there are a few old black beams on the ceiling. Several copper pans were hung on the walls as well as a few horse brasses and such like.

Beers on tap were Butcombe and Sharp’s Atlantic, whilst a third pump appeared to have run out. Ciders meanwhile were Ashton Press, Thatcher’s Haze and somewhat unusually on draught, Natch.
